The video introduces the properties and states of matter, focusing on solids, liquids, and gases. It explains how matter is defined by mass and volume, and how different states of matter behave. The lesson uses water as an example to illustrate the transitions between solid, liquid, and gas. The video concludes with a recap of the key points discussed.
